Need Excel to use a 5 Day Week
I am trying to create a scheduling spreadsheet. I enter an end date in the date code and then work backwards to get the deadline dates for the different processes. My problem is that we only work 5 days a week and often the deadlines will be Saturday or Sunday. Is there some way to get Excel to figure only a 5 day week and completely ignore Saturday and Sunday? See the WORKDAY and NETWORKDAYS functions.
